Khate
Pontone presents mixtape dedicated to Khate, one-woman conjurer hailing from Virginia. Her last LP “Pareidolia” is one of the finest examples of using ambient sound, found sound and other oddities to take the listener elsewhere in the world.

Bonnie Prince Billy
We present guide to Bonnie ‘Prince’ Billy, alias Will Oldham – one of our favourite artists who has just released (another) fantastic LP called “Lie Down In The Light“. The compilation is based on material made under his Bonnie ‘Prince’ Billy moniker (there is one exception though). Early songs which Will Oldham recorded as Palace Music, Palace Brothers will be subject of mix in near future.
